About The Book

<p><em>Trade Competition and Domestic Regulatory Policy</em> presents a unique combination of analysis of both international trade and investment policies and competition and regulatory policies. Increasingly policymakers businesses and the law and economics professions need to better understand how changes and policy developments in international trade and competition developed and how their interaction impacts on global business. </p><p>In addition to providing a comprehensive analysis of the attempts of international trade theory and practice to deal with tariffs non-tariff barriers market distortions and failures to protect various kinds of property rights this book contains a detailed treatment of how property rights protection including intangible property rights are a critical element of ensuring open trade and competitive markets. It examines how these rights have developed over time and how they have been integrated into trade and competition policy. </p><p>This book will be of significant interest to students of international business professors of economics law and business and policymakers at the intersection of trade investment competition and property rights.</p>
